Presearch Bolsters Web3 Transition With PRE Token Beta Launch On Base Layer 2

Presearch, a decentralized meta-search engine, has advanced its Web3 transition by launching its PRE token in beta on Base, a layer 2 blockchain supported by Coinbase.

The company, which avoids tracking users or selling their data to advertisers, announced this development as part of its ongoing effort to create a fully decentralized search ecosystem, enhancing accessibility and efficiency for its users and advertisers while addressing long-standing challenges like high transaction fees.

The shift to Base Layer-2, designed to improve scalability and reduce costs for on-chain activities, enables Presearch to offer self-custodial staking mechanisms, allowing users to maintain full control over their assets while earning or staking PRE tokens for keyword ads.
